Output 4034dc90aba547bc78dfb1ea7ebaced2492e6081d50f41059cf039a0be03e341:42

value
2752213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3917661b39df2d75a4808d99d705ff5198ccea07 OP_EQUAL
address
36ttUFyAX8YG1nbZomA4e8PquC14fPJWPB
transaction
4034dc90aba547bc78dfb1ea7ebaced2492e6081d50f41059cf039a0be03e341
spent
true